Handover: Template Rendering Performance — Quillstone Pipeline

Before the release cut, note that partial-template caching landed on Tuesday and reduced median render time from 340ms to 110ms. However, nested includes deeper than four levels still bypass the cache, and I've flagged this in the tracker. Marisol has the profiling traces if you need evidence for the go/no-go call. The warm-up job must run before traffic shifts. Current benchmarks and regression history are maintained on the page below.

runbook for kahof-yaweg: https://superset.tolvaqdyn.test/settings/repo/projects/display/68a0f19bdd1535be

## Local Setup

The Digestly scheduler composes and queues batch email digests using a cron-like table stored in Postgres. Before running anything, install dependencies with `make deps` and apply migrations with `make migrate` — the schedule table must exist or the worker will crash-loop. Digest windows are computed in UTC, and the worker persists its last-run checkpoint after each batch, so never truncate the checkpoint table during testing. To run the scheduler locally, configure the database connection using the string below.

replica DSN, tawef-hahap: mysql://eliix_svc:FiIC0jz@db-394a.lumiclabs.internal:5432/holius

The Lumenpass audit tool scans every Driftboard UI build for WCAG contrast failures. Results post to the internal Hueledger service nightly. Security review scope: confirm the audit pipeline cannot exfiltrate screenshots outside the Hueledger boundary, and that report access is role-gated. Audit runs are read-only against production assets. To replicate a run locally, authenticate against Hueledger staging with the internal key provided directly below.

API key for yahig-tadup: kto7_ubizbYm

**Handover: DedupeDaemon**

From: Ilsa. To: whoever's on call next.

DedupeDaemon collapses duplicate alerts before they hit the pager. It choked twice this week — both times the fingerprint window was too narrow after Tuesday's redeploy. I widened it and restarted the Kerrow cluster nodes. Watch the suppression queue; if it climbs past a few hundred, bounce the service, don't tune blindly. Escalate to Rufo only if both replicas die. Current running config is below.

service settings:
[casax]
port = 6379
team = rusir
host = casax.zemvarhq.corp
region = outer-4
access_code = ac_9808ce
timeout_ms = 1500